    <title>1988 (9) TMI 319 - ANDHRA PRADESH HIGH COURT</title>
    <link>https://www.taxtmi.com/caselaws?id=155662</link>
    <description>Sales tax could not be levied on royalty and extraction charges under an agreement for supply of bamboo and hardwood where the arrangement did not amount to a sale; the same principle applied to both commodities, and prospective demand or collection was restrained. Refund of tax already collected was refused because the petitioner did not plead or prove that the burden had not been passed on to consumers, and refund would have resulted in unjust enrichment. Section 33-BB of the Andhra Pradesh General Sales Tax Act was treated as reflecting that principle, so the writ succeeded only to the extent of preventing future levy.</description>
